This book is just as the title describes it. The first 40 pages give an overview of fabric, sewing supplies, and the quilting process with tips and photographs sprinkled throughout. I loved her tip about using organizer cards during the quilt process! The quilt projects are divided across three categories: Getting Started, Confident Beginner, and Intermediate - which makes this a great book to grow with, as you increase your skills and confidence. Several of the quilts would work great with fabric scraps. With each pattern she includes at least 3 different color schemes to illustrate how the same quilt can take on a completely different look when you change the fabric. Highly recommended.
